Significant differences between Orange chicken and Salisbury steak

  • Orange chicken has more Vitamin K, Selenium, Vitamin B5, Vitamin B3, Vitamin A RAE, Vitamin B2, and Vitamin B6, however, Salisbury steak is richer in Vitamin B12.
  • Orange chicken covers your daily Vitamin K needs 19% more than Salisbury steak.
  • Salisbury steak has 38 times less Vitamin A RAE than Orange chicken. Orange chicken has 75µg of Vitamin A RAE, while Salisbury steak has 2µg.
  • Salisbury steak contains less Cholesterol.

Specific food types used in this comparison are Restaurant, Chinese, orange chicken and Salisbury steak with gravy, frozen.
